Most evolutions are by just leveling up but there are also many evolutions like togepi evolves into togetic but friendship and then togetic evolves by a shiny stone. Eevee evolves by the stones, by training at night or day and by leveling it upnext to the icy or grassy stones. Pokemon like golem, machamp, electrivire and magmortar all avolve by giving them the right hold item and trading them.Typically baby Pokemon evolve by friendship if a Pokemon doesn't evolve by by Lv. 55 then it evolves by a stone and if that doesn't work look for held items for Pokemon evolutions.
